K Kasturirangan passed away on Friday morning at his residence in Bengaluru. He had been a towering figure in India’s development, leading the Indian Space Research Organisation (ISRO) for over nine years. Under his leadership, India’s space program made great strides in satellite launches and research. After his contribution to India’s space achievements, he took on the important responsibility of drafting and leading India’s New Education Policy, a major reform aimed at changing the future of the Indian education system.

In his lifetime, Kasturirangan served in several important roles. He was the Chancellor of Jawaharlal Nehru University (JNU), the Chairman of the Karnataka Knowledge Commission, a nominated Member of the Rajya Sabha, and a Member of the erstwhile Planning Commission of India. He also served as the Director of the National Institute of Advanced Studies in Bengaluru between 2004 and 2009.
